A bizarre case of electricity billing dispute has surfaced from Gothakeli village under Dhepaguda panchayat in Gajapati district, where a family without an active electricity connection has reportedly received a power bill of Rs 10,470.
The bill has been issued in the name of Surendra Mallick, a resident who passed away nearly 15 years ago. His visually impaired mother and son, who currently live in the house, have alleged that there is no electricity supply to their residence. The family survives on daily wage work, and their house was recently allotted under a housing scheme, but without any power connection.
